HC Deb 18 May 1966 vol 728 cc253-4W
71. Mr. Arthur Pearson

asked the Minister of Agriculture, Fisheries and Food what stage has been reached in the preparation of the scheme of flood prevention for the River Taff where it passes through the Treforest Industrial Estate; and if work will commence on the scheme during the coming summer months.

Mr. John Mackie

Further details are awaited from the Glamorgan River Authority of its proposals now estimated to cost about £240,000 for the protection of this industrial estate. When these are available a decision on the question of grant will be given as quickly as possible but it is too early to say when work is likely to start.
